Patriots’ 2026 Kickoff Odds and Past Super Bowl Rematch Narrative Emerge
The New England Patriots' odds for their 2026 NFL Kickoff Game against the Seattle Seahawks are being discussed, framed by the Patriots' opportunity to avenge a past Super Bowl loss.

Boston, MA, September 8, 2026 —
Discussions surrounding the upcoming 2026 NFL season are beginning to surface, with particular attention being paid to the opening game involving the New England Patriots. The Patriots are slated to face the Seattle Seahawks in their 2026 NFL Kickoff Game, a matchup that is drawing attention not only for its competitive prospects but also for its narrative potential.
The conversation around this early-season fixture is significantly framed by the opportunity for the New England Patriots to potentially avenge a past Super Bowl loss against the Seattle Seahawks. This historical context adds a layer of anticipation for the contest, suggesting a storyline of redemption for the Patriots.
